Alderman <sean.m.alderman@grc.nasa.gov> via eLink9.0.1 lapi doesn't have access to the field which needs to be set forexpiration. I have found this to be the case with severalthings...where lapi doesn't have access to a setting or bit of data thatchanges something, where the web interface does have said access. If Iremember correctly, this is the case also with setting a document to bea catalog item in a folder. You can not set this field, because itdoesn't exist in the LAPI definition for ObjectInfo object.
